1. 数据预处理的重要性在于( )
A. 提高数据质量 B. 提高计算效率 C. 提高数据的可视化效果 D. 以上都是
2. 数据清洗中,以下哪种方法不是常见的清洗方法?( )
A. 删除重复项 B. 删除缺失值 C. 替换异常值 D. 合并不同数据源
3. 在数据转换中,将数据从一种形式转换为另一种形式的过程被称为( )
A. 归一化 B. 标度 C. 聚类 D. 分类
4. 对于有缺失值的 dataset,以下哪种做法是正确的?( )
A. 直接删除缺失值 B. 用平均值或中位数填充 C. 使用机器学习模型预测缺失值 D. 以上都可以
5. 数据可视化的目的是( )
A. 探索数据 B. 展示数据 C. 发现数据中的规律 D. 所有 above
6. 在数据可视化中,以下哪种图表适合展示时间序列数据?( )
A. 条形图 B. 折线图 C. 饼图 D. 以上都可以
7. 关于数据预处理,以下哪项属于数据分析与建模方面的内容?( )
A. 数据清洗 B. 缺失值处理 C. 特征工程 D. 所有 above
8. 在数据清洗中,以下哪种方法可以去除不必要的数据?( )
A. 删除重复项 B. 删除缺失值 C. 替换异常值 D. 合并不同数据源
9. 在数据可视化中,以下哪种方法可以用来展示数据的分布情况?( )
A. 柱状图 B. 折线图 C. 饼图 D. 以上都可以
10. 在数据预处理中,对数据进行标准化处理的作用是( )
A. 使数据具有相似性 B. 减少数据维度 C. 消除数据差异 D. 以上都是
11. 在IT行业中,数据预处理主要应用于( )
A. 数据库管理 B. 网络数据监测 C. 数据分析与建模 D. 人工智能
12. 在数据收集阶段,以下哪种方法可能导致数据质量问题?( )
A. 通过问卷调查收集数据 B. 从公开数据源获取数据 C. 使用爬虫收集数据 D. 直接从网络上抓取数据
13. 关于数据清洗,以下哪种操作可以帮助消除数据中的错误?( )
A. 去重 B. 替换异常值 C. 合并不同数据源 D. 数据降维
14. 在进行数据分析之前,需要对数据进行( )
A. 缺失值处理 B. 数据类型转换 C. 数据合并 D. 以上都对
15. 在数据可视化中,以下哪种图表适合展示分类数据?( )
A. 条形图 B. 折线图 C. 饼图 D. 直方图
16. 在进行回归分析时,以下哪个变量可能是自变量?( )
A. 性别 B. 年龄 C. 收入 D. 星座
17. 在进行聚类分析时,以下哪个过程可以帮助确定聚类的数量?( )
A. K均值算法 B. 层次聚类 C. 密度聚类 D. 以上都可以
18. 在进行时间序列分析时,以下哪个指标可以帮助检测趋势?( )
A. MA指标 B. MACD指标 C. ATR指标 D. 以上都可以
19. 在进行数据归一化处理时,以下哪种方法不会改变数据的范围?( )
A. min-max归一化 B. z-score归一化 C. standardize归一化 D. none of the above
20. 在进行数据预处理时,以下哪种操作可以帮助消除数据中的噪声?( )
A. 数据平滑 B. 数据降维 C. 数据清洗 D. 以上都可以二、问答题
1. 什么是数据预处理?
2. 数据预处理中数据清洗的重要性是什么?
3. 数据转换的主要目的是什么?
4. 什么是缺失值?如何处理缺失值?
5. 什么是数据归一化和标度?为什么它们重要?
6. 数据可视化有哪些重要作用?
7. 如何选择合适的数据可视化方式?
8. 什么是机器学习?机器学习有哪些应用场景?
9. 什么是Python?Python在数据分析和机器学习领域有哪些常用库?
10. 数据预处理在IT行业中的具体应用有哪些?
参考答案
选择题:
1. D 2. D 3. B 4. D 5. D 6. B 7. D 8. A 9. A 10. D
11. C 12. D 13. B 14. D 15. D 16. A 17. A 18. B 19. D 20. D
问答题:
1. 什么是数据预处理?
数据预处理是指对原始数据进行一系列的处理和转换,以便于进行更深入的数据分析和建模工作。它包括数据收集、数据清洗、数据转换、数据分析等多个环节。
思路
:首先了解数据预处理的概念和重要性,然后依次介绍数据来源、数据清洗方法、数据转换技巧、数据分析与建模策略以及数据可视化最佳实践。
2. 数据预处理中数据清洗的重要性是什么?
数据清洗是数据预处理中非常重要的一环,它的主要目的是去除数据中的噪声、异常值、缺失值等,从而提高数据的质量和准确性。
思路
:解释数据清洗的目的和重要性,然后详细介绍常见的数据清洗方法和技巧。
3. 数据转换的主要目的是什么?
数据转换的主要目的是将数据从一种形式转换为另一种形式,以便于后续的数据分析和建模工作。
思路
:首先解释数据转换的目的,然后具体介绍常用的数据转换技巧和实践。
4. 什么是缺失值?如何处理缺失值?
缺失值是指数据集中某些变量缺少数值的情况。处理缺失值的方法主要有删除、填充、插值等。
思路
:先解释缺失值的定义和影响,然后详细介绍常见的缺失值处理方法及其优缺点。
5. 什么是数据归一化和标度?为什么它们重要?
数据归一化是将数据转化为同一缩放范围内的值,以便于各个变量之间的比较。标度是数据归一化的一种特殊形式,主要用于消除不同变量之间量纲的影响。它们在数据分析和建模中具有重要意义,因为它们可以改变模型的收敛速度和效果。
思路
:首先解释数据归一化和标度的概念,然后阐述其在数据分析和建模中的重要性。
6. 数据可视化有哪些重要作用?
数据可视化是将数据以图形或图像的形式展示出来,可以帮助我们更直观地理解数据,发现数据背后的规律和趋势。
思路
:先解释数据可视化的作用,然后介绍多种数据可视化方式和技巧,最后强调数据可视化在数据分析和建模中的应用价值。
7. 如何选择合适的数据可视化方式?
选择合适的数据可视化方式需要根据数据的特点和需求来决定。例如,对于时间序列数据,折线图和柱状图是较为合适的选择;而对于分类数据,条形图和饼图则更为适用。
思路
:首先解释数据可视化方式的选择原则,然后举例说明不同类型数据应采用何种可视化方式。
8. 什么是机器学习?机器学习有哪些应用场景?
机器学习是人工智能的一个分支,它通过训练数据自动学习数据的特征和规律,从而实现对新数据的预测和分类。机器学习有很多应用场景,如推荐系统、自然语言处理、图像识别等。
思路
:首先解释机器学习的概念,然后介绍机器学习在各个领域的应用场景。
9. 什么是Python?Python在数据分析和机器学习领域有哪些常用库?
Python是一种高级编程语言,具有易学易用、跨平台等特点。在数据分析和机器学习领域,常用的Python库有NumPy、Pandas、Matplotlib、Scikit-learn等。
思路
:首先解释Python的优点和特点,然后介绍NumPy、Pandas、Matplotlib、Scikit-learn等常用库的功能和用途。
10. 数据预处理在IT行业中的具体应用有哪些?
数据预处理在IT行业中的具体应用非常广泛,例如在网络安全领域,可以通过数据预处理技术处理和分析日志数据,从而发现潜在的安全威胁;在金融领域,可以通过数据预处理技术对交易数据进行分析,预测市场走势等。
思路
:首先解释数据预处理在IT行业中的重要性,然后举例说明数据预处理技术在不同领域的具体应用。